As a very important role of world economy, China has made a tremendous achievement of utilizing foreign investment since the reform and opening up. China's agriculture began to utilize foreign investment in the end of 70's, when the reform and opening up just started. Agriculture is one of the earliest industries to utilize foreign investment. The new government has been paying unprecedented attention to agriculture due to its strategic position in the development of economy in China. Then Documents about agriculture has been issued again by the authorities in 2005. Solving the problems facing agriculture, rural areas and farmers has been the most important task for the government. Therefore, under the background that more and more attention has been paid to agriculture, it has both theoretical and practical significance to study how to expand, introduce and utilize foreign investment effectively and efficiently to promote agricultural modernization, industrialization and internationalization. This dissertation is composed of four parts (five chapters) to discuss the central topic "Utilization of Foreign Investments in Agriculture of China".In part one, the background, purpose, significance, content and methodology of this study are introduced and an overview of the past and current studies and researches is presented (Chapter 1). Besides, the basic theories of agriculture utilizing foreign investment are summarized (Chapter 2).In part two, the characteristics of agriculture utilizing foreign investment in China are summarized according to its development, status quo and problems existing in the developing process. Moreover, the model of FDI's contribution to agriculture economic growth is set up to analyze relations between agricultural GDP and FDI in agriculture. Also, this part sets up a multivariate regression model of FDI and its influence factors such as the level of agriculture economic development, human capital, the extent of agricultural internationalization and investment climate, etc. The quantitative analysis can provide the data support for government policy.In part three, through introducing the international experiences and lessons of agriculture utilizing foreign investment in developed countries (America and Korea) and in developing countries (Thailand, India, Brazil and Indonesia), some inspirations have been drawn for foreign investment utilization in our agriculture.Based on the theoretical and empirical analysis of the status quo, problems and the influence factors of agriculture utilizing foreign investment, learning its international experiences and lessons, part four comes up with some concluding remarks and policy suggestions as follows: agriculture in China should further strengthen the development and exploit market potential; improve agricultural investment climate and upgrade the superiority of introducing foreign capital; intensify high-quality foreign investment introduction and increase the utilizing efficiency; enhance the supervision and control of both domestic and foreign markets as well as establish and consummate rules and regulations.
